The first of these two Pokemon isRegidrago,the Dragon-type Legendary Titan that was first introduced in Pokemon’s eighth generation. This will be a tough PvE encounter without a doubt, so here are the best strategies to use for this specific Raid battle.

Like withother Elite Raids,putting together a group will require some degree of coordination,disabling the use of Remote Raid Passesfor this specific type of Raid. Luckily, Regidrago is not the toughest opponent, meaning that it won’t require you to go into it with an extremely large group of players.

For this Raid, it’s best if you attempt it with agroup size of three to five players,again, all needing to be there in person for this Elite Raid. Additionally, you will want to make sure that all members of your Raid team are using strong Pokemon that counter Regidrago, due to the lack of a damage bonus that is typically provided to players who are raiding remotely.

Due to the potential difficulty of getting together a large, in-person group for this Raid, the use of theMega EvolutionandPrimal Reversionmechanic is a must.

This will provide your Raid team with additional damage in this battle, applying adamage increase to certain attacksdepending on which Pokemon you and your allies have Mega Evolved or Primal Reverted.

Regidrago: Strengths And Weaknesses

Being a pure Dragon-typd, there are specific types that Regidrago is strong and weak against. With this Raid Pokemon possessing a significant amount of HP, it’s important to take advantage of Regidrago’s vulnerabilities,Dragon, Fairy, and Ice-type attacks.Attacks of these types will deal significantly more damage than those of other types, proving to be the most effective attack types for this Elite Raid.

Now it’s time to discuss the attack types that you’ll want to avoid using against Regidrago. It possesses four different resistances in battle, toFire, Water, Grass, and Electric-type attacks.Due to these types of attacks dealing reduced damage against Regidrago, avoid using Pokemon that attack with any of them.

To further increase your overall effectiveness in this Raid, make sure to put together a team of Pokemon that benefit fromSame Type Attack Bonusif possible.

To do this, ensure you are usingPokemon that have attacks that match their type,increasing the damage of these attacks as a result.

Regidrago: Best Counter Picks

When building your team of six Pokemon for this Elite Raid, you will want to verify that itconsists of mainly Dragon, Fairy, and Ice-type Pokemon.These Pokemon will most likely possess attacks that match their types, not only benefiting from using attacks that Regidrago is weak against, but also benefiting from the Same Type Attack Bonus mechanic.
